In an opposite-sex marital relationship, if a kid is born or developed throughout the marital relationship and the husband is not the dad, this adds another lawful concern to resolve. Under Michigan regulation, a partner is presumed to be the legal daddy of any kid birthed or conceived during the marriage. To ask a court to withdraw the husband's legal paternity, either the mommy, the hubby, or the natural father can file a Motion or Grievance to Determine Youngster Born Out of Wedlock.

What percent of divorce instances are settled without a test?

Greater than 90 percent of separation instances work out before test & #x 2014; either by one spouse offering a negotiation that the other accepts, or at arbitration.
